Job Description
Seaward Services, Inc currently seeks a Machinist/Welder. This position is responsible for welding steel, aluminum, stainless steel, machine parts and fabricate parts or systems in support of maintenance, repair, and test and evaluation operations in a fashion that exceeds the highest standards within the industry while promoting and maintaining the utmost integrity and the highest standard of service to all customers.

Essential Functions – The following duties are normal for this position. The omission of specific statements of duties does not exclude them from the classification if the work is similar, related, or a logical assignment for this classification.  Other duties may be required and assigned.

  • This person shall have a minimum of a welding or machinist certification or two years experience working as a full time welder, machinist or fabricator.
  • This person shall be proficient with MIG welding of aluminum and steel.  Also prefer proficiency with TIG, and stick welding of all types of metals.
  • Able to complete class/certification to operate machine shop equipment to include milling, cutting, drilling and bending/forming machines.
  • Required to operate forklifts and other material handling equipment.
  • Maintain active list of project timelines and prioritize job tasks.
  • Inspect parts to assure conformance to specification.
  • Remain technically current.
  • Analyze technical data.
  • Perform special projects.
  • Experience with supporting military and commercial, maintenance, repair and fabrication operations.
  • Able to effectively provide verbal and written communication with government personnel and/or customers.
  • Maintain compliance with US Navy and OSHA requirements and a clean and safe work area at all times.


 Education/Certifications

  1. Civilian or military Welding or Machinist Certification.
  2. High School Diploma or Equivalency required.
  3. Must be able to obtain Secret Clearance.
  4. Valid and Clean Driver’s License.
  5. Must wear Company uniform and required safety equipment
  6. Must be a minimum of 18 years of age


Required Skills

  • Two years' experience with general machine shop practice; interpreting drawings and specifications, planning and laying out of work, using a variety of machinist’s hand tools and precision measuring instrument, setting up and operating standard machine tools, making standard shop computations relating to dimensions of work, tolling, feeds and speeds of machining, familiarity with the properties of metals commonly used in marine applications, including stainless steels, aluminum, and copper alloys.
  • Will be required to perform welding and machining of ferrous and non-ferrous metals to repair, maintain and fabricate parts for small boats, vessels and support US Navy operations as required.
  • Expected to work outside normal hours of operations as mission/fleet support requirements dictate.
  • May be required to travel on short notice as mission/fleet support requirements dictate.


Working Conditions

  • Mental: Ability to determine safe or unsafe conditions.  Process calculations.
  • Physical: Ability to carry materials weighing upwards of 100 lbs.
  • Use of Senses: Observe for safety. Vision correctible to 20/40. Full color vision, no night blindness. Full range of all limbs.
  • Environment: Outside conditions, extreme temperatures.  Marine operation may be subject to varied wake and motion.
